Applications
2-Octanol, 8,8-bis(isotridecyloxy)-2,6-dimethyl- (CAS 67923-85-7) is a bulky di-alkyl ether bearing two isotridecyloxy groups, with high lipophilicity, and is typically used as a nonionic surfactant and specialty solvent. In coatings, inks and adhesives it functions as a wetting agent, emulsifier and dispersant for hydrophobic components. In industrial manufacturing it can serve as a processing aid and solvent for complex formulations. It may act as a plasticizer or processing additive in polymers and elastomers to improve flexibility and compatibility. In cosmetics and perfumery it may be used as a fragrance solvent or a fixative component. In household cleaners and consumer products it can act as an emulsifier or solvent to stabilize formulations. Use is subject to local regulations and formulation limits.
